Cross Reference: Makefile
xref: /src/distrib/mac68k/instkernel/ramdisk/Makefile
  • Home
  • History
  • Annotate
  • Line#
  • Navigate
  • Raw
  • Download
  • only in /src/distrib/mac68k/instkernel/ramdisk/
Makefile revision 1.17
1#	$NetBSD: Makefile,v 1.17 2002/03/25 07:43:43 lukem Exp $
2
3.include "${.CURDIR}/../../../Makefile.inc"
4.include <bsd.own.mk>
5
6.ifndef NOTESOBJDIR
7NOTESOBJDIR!=cd ${DISTRIBDIR}/notes/mac68k && ${PRINTOBJDIR}
8.endif
9
10IMAGE=		ramdisk.fs
11IMAGESIZE=	2048k
12
13WARNS=		1
14
15CRUNCHBIN=	ramdiskbin
16LISTS=		${.CURDIR}/list ${DISTRIBDIR}/common/list.sysinst
17MTREECONF=	${DISTRIBDIR}/common/mtree.common
18IMAGEENDIAN=	be
19MAKEDEVTARGETS=	raminst
20IMAGEDEPENDS=	${CRUNCHBIN} \
21		disktab.preinstall dot.profile dot.hdprofile \
22		${.CURDIR}/../../miniroot/termcap \
23		${NOTESOBJDIR}/INSTALL.more \
24		${_SRC_TOP_}/etc/group \
25		${_SRC_TOP_}/etc/master.passwd \
26		${_SRC_TOP_}/etc/protocols \
27		${_SRC_TOP_}/etc/netconfig \
28		${_SRC_TOP_}/etc/services
29
30
31realall: ${IMAGE}
32
33release:
34
35
36# Use stubs to eliminate some large stuff from libc
37HACKSRC=${DISTRIBDIR}/utils/libhack
38.include "${HACKSRC}/Makefile.inc"
39
40# This is listed in ramdiskbin.conf but is built here.
41${CRUNCHBIN}: libhack.o
42
43
44.include "${DISTRIBDIR}/common/Makefile.crunch"
45.include "${DISTRIBDIR}/common/Makefile.makedev"
46.include "${DISTRIBDIR}/common/Makefile.image"
47
48PARSELISTENV+=	NOTESOBJDIR=${NOTESOBJDIR}
49
50.include <bsd.prog.mk>
51

Indexes created Mon Dec 15 09:09:35 GMT 2025